It was with a divine calling to plant a place of worship that pastor Tim Parsons and his family began the thriving Center Point Church in Lexington, KY. This loving church offers the perfect sanctuary for families, individuals, and lost souls searching for the word of God. For more than a decade, hundreds of believers have chosen this dedicated staff and welcoming congregation as their church home

. Center Point Church is committed to bringing to life their vision of creating communities of disciples through education and outreach programs. By following the guidelines outlined in the Bible, every part of this church body is heavily rooted in scripture. From in-depth Bible studies to powerful worship services, pastors and staff will work hard to help you and your family grow your faith. As you step into the open facility for Sunday services, you’ll be greeted by an inviting welcome team that truly cares about getting to know you. Staff members also prepare free coffee and tea for you to sip and enjoy during services. Guests will have a rewarding experience worshiping the Lord while talented musicians and leaders play a variety of musical styles. Your children can take advantage of fun youth groups and summer Bible studies. From exciting preschool classes to encouraging college programs, the student ministry at Center Point Church is flourishing. Regardless of how you choose to serve, there’s something for every member of your family to participate in to spread the good word. Sunday recap!!

This past Sunday we continued our series in the book of Judges as we dove into chapters 4 & 5. This passage of scripture pointed out that our holiness cannot depend on our heroes, and our courage cannot depend on our companions. As Christians we must grow in holiness despite the circumstances, who may be around us, and the spiritual leaders in our lives. We must depend on the Gospel and Jesus’ sacrifice on the cross for our salvation, making melody to the Lord for all that he has done.

So, what melody are you singing to God this week?
